pub trait ImageTransformer
where
Self: PartialEq,
Self: Sized + Clone,
Self: Display + Debug,
{
/// Transform the given image in place
fn transform(&self, input: &mut DynamicImage);
/// Parse an arg string.
///
/// `name({arg_string})`
fn parse_args(args: &str) -> Result<Self, String>;
}
use serde::{Deserialize, Deserializer};
/// An enum of all [`ImageTransformer`]s
#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q)]
pub enum TransformerEnum {
/// Usage: `maxdim(w, h)`
///
/// Scale the image so its width is smaller than `w`
/// and its height is smaller than `h`. Aspect ratio is preserved.
///
/// To only limit the size of one dimension, use `vw` or `vh`.
/// For example, `maxdim(50,100vh)` will not limit width.
MaxDim(MaxDimTransformer),
/// Usage: `crop(w, h, float)`
///
/// Crop the image to at most `w` by `h` pixels,
/// floating the crop area in the specified direction.
///
/// Directions are one of:
/// - Cardinal: n,e,s,w
/// - Diagonal: ne,nw,se,sw,
/// - Centered: c
///
/// Examples:
/// - `crop(100vw, 50)` gets the top 50 pixels of the image \
/// (or fewer, if the image's height is smaller than 50)
///
/// To only limit the size of one dimension, use `vw` or `vh`.
/// For example, `maxdim(50,100vh)` will not limit width.
Crop(CropTransformer),
/// Usage: `format(format)`
///
/// Transcode the image to the given format.
/// This step must be last, and cannot be provided
/// more than once.
///
/// Valid formats:
/// - bmp
/// - gif
/// - ico
/// - jpeg or jpg
/// - png
/// - qoi
/// - webp
///
/// Example:
/// - `format(png)`
///
/// When transcoding an animated gif, the first frame is taken
/// and all others are thrown away. This happens even if we
/// transcode from a gif to a gif.
Format { format: ImageFormat },
}

@@ -1,149 +0,0 @@
use proc_macro::TokenStream;
use quote::quote;
use std::path::PathBuf;
use syn::{LitStr, parse_macro_input};
/// A macro for parsing Sass/SCSS files at compile time.
///
/// This macro takes a file path to a Sass/SCSS file, compiles it to CSS at compile time
/// using the `grass` compiler, and returns the resulting CSS as a `&'static str`.
///
/// # Behavior
///
/// Similar to `include_str!`, this macro:
/// - Reads the specified file at compile time
/// - Compiles the Sass/SCSS to CSS using `grass::from_path()` with default options
/// - Handles `@import` and `@use` directives, resolving imported files relative to the main file
/// - Embeds the resulting CSS string in the binary
/// - Returns a `&'static str` containing the compiled CSS
///
/// # Syntax
///
/// ```notrust
/// sass!("path/to/file.scss")
/// ```
///
/// # Arguments
///
/// - A string literal containing the path to the Sass/SCSS file (relative to the crate root)
///
/// # Example
///
/// ```notrust
/// // Relative to crate root: looks for src/routes/css/main.scss
/// const MY_STYLES: &str = sass!("src/routes/css/main.scss");
///
/// // Use in HTML generation
/// html! {
/// style { (PreEscaped(MY_STYLES)) }
/// }
/// ```
///
/// # Import Support
///
/// The macro fully supports Sass imports and uses:
/// ```notrust
/// // main.scss
/// @import "variables";
/// @use "mixins";
///
/// .button {
/// color: $primary-color;
/// }
/// ```
///
/// All imported files are resolved relative to the location of the main Sass file.
///
/// # Compile-time vs Runtime
///
/// Instead of this runtime code:
/// ```notrust
/// let css = grass::from_path(
/// "styles.scss",
/// &grass::Options::default()
/// ).unwrap();
/// ```
///
/// You can use:
/// ```notrust
/// const CSS: &str = sass!("styles.scss");
/// ```
///
/// # Panics
///
/// This macro will cause a compile error if:
/// - The specified file does not exist
/// - The file path is invalid
/// - The Sass/SCSS file contains syntax errors
/// - Any imported files cannot be found
/// - The grass compiler fails for any reason
///
/// # Note
///
/// The file path is relative to the crate root (where `Cargo.toml` is located), determined
/// by the `C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R` environment variable. This is similar to how `include!()` works
/// but differs from `include_str!()` which is relative to the current file.
